OK, but you can do the following now. NB you still need the declarations for the 
function, only the IF block replaces the IFIN.


SET VAR arg1 TEXT = 'Mr'
SET VAR arg2 TEXT = '(Ms,Miss,Mrs,Mme,Madam)'
SET VAR arg3 TEXT = 'FEMALE'
SET VAR arg4 TEXT = 'MALE'
SET VAR arg5 TEXT

IF arg1 IN .arg2 THEN
   SET VAR arg5 = .arg3
  ELSE
   SET VAR arg5 = .arg4
ENDIF

>> Unfortunately I haven't had time to be a beta tester for the new
>> versions, but I do have a function request that might help someone
>> beyond just me. �If you are a beta tester and would find it useful
>> would you please submit the idea for me? �Thanks! �Here's the
>> function:
>>
>> �If arg1 is IN arg2list return arg3, otherwise return arg4.
>> �(IFIN(arg1,arg2list,arg3,arg4))
>>
>> This could easily be used in a select statement for example:
>>
>> SELECT (IFIN(title,'Mrs,Ms,Miss','Female','Male')) +
>> � FROM tableview
>>
>> Would display Male or Female based on the IFIN list. �Otherwise you
>> have to use 3 IFEQ functions to accomplish the same thing.
>> Occasionally my statements have gone over the limit, so I end up
>> looking for creative ways to accomplish this type of statement.
